THE SANDERS-STALLINGS STORYBOOK COTTAGE A Rare Fairytale European Cottage in Historic Smithfield AN ENCHANTING SWISS CHALET-INSPIRED LANDMARK IN HISTORIC SMITHFIELD The Sanders-Stallings Storybook Cottage is one of the most architecturally distinctive and historically significant residences in Johnston County. Rising gracefully along North 3rd Street beneath a canopy of mature trees walking distance to downtown center, this extraordinary 3108 square foot 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om circa-1927 home appears as though it was transported from a European fairytale village and lovingly placed in the heart of Historic Smithfield. Built for William Marsh Sanders Jr., owner of Sanders Ford Motor Company and a member of one of Smithfield's most influential families, the home reflects a remarkable chapter in the town's history. Constructed during the optimism and prosperity of the Roaring Twenties, when automobiles were transforming American life and Smithfield was emerging as a thriving commercial center, the residence became a symbol of craftsmanship, innovation, and enduring beauty. Known historically as the Sanders-Stallings House, the property showcases rare Swiss Chalet-inspired architecture seldom found in North Carolina. Its soaring curved gable, decorative half-timbering, charming dormer windows, exposed rafter tails, and handcrafted details create an unmistakable silhouette that has captivated residents and visitors for nearly a century. Over time, admirers have affectionately come to regard it as Smithfield's Storybook Cottage a designation earned through its whimsical character, historic significance, and unforgettable presence. The home was built during the dawn of the automobile age. Historic records show Sanders Motor Company receiving railcar shipments of Ford automobiles into Smithfield as the town entered a period of extraordinary growth and prosperity. As one of the community's prominent families helped shape the future of Johnston County, this remarkable residence stood as a reflection of both ambition and artistry. Through the Great Depression, World War II, the post-war boom, and the transformation of Johnston County into one of North Carolina's fastest-growing regions, the Sanders-Stallings Storybook Cottage has remained a cherished landmark and silent witness to generations of local history. The home was willed to family members for the past three generations. For the first time in over 70 years, the doors to the home are open for the next new owners. Today, it remains one of the crown jewels of the North Smithfield Historic District, offering a rare opportunity to own not simply a home, but a piece of Smithfield's architectural and cultural heritage.
